Genetic testing has become increasingly popular in recent years as advancements in technology have made it more accessible and affordable. These tests can provide valuable information about an individual’s genetic makeup, including their risk for certain diseases, ancestry, and even traits like eye color or hair texture.

One of the most common uses of genetic testing is to assess an individual’s risk for developing certain diseases. By analyzing an individual’s DNA, healthcare providers can identify specific genetic mutations that are associated with an increased risk of conditions like cancer, heart disease, or Alzheimer’s disease. Armed with this information, individuals can take proactive steps to manage their risk, such as making lifestyle changes or undergoing regular screenings.

Genetic testing can also be used to diagnose rare genetic disorders that may be causing unexplained symptoms or health issues. In some cases, identifying the underlying genetic cause of a condition can help healthcare providers tailor treatment plans more effectively, improving patient outcomes. Additionally, genetic testing can be used to determine an individual’s response to certain medications, helping to avoid potentially harmful side effects or the need for trial-and-error dosing.

Another popular application of genetic testing is ancestry testing, which can provide individuals with information about their ethnic background and geographical origins. By comparing an individual’s DNA to reference populations from around the world, these tests can provide insights into one’s genetic heritage and help individuals trace their family lineage. This information can be particularly valuable for individuals who are adopted or have limited knowledge about their family history.

In addition to health-related and ancestry testing, genetic tests can also be used to assess individual traits and characteristics. Some companies offer direct-to-consumer genetic tests that provide information about traits like eye color, hair texture, or even physical fitness potential. While these tests can be fun and insightful, it’s important to remember that they may not always be accurate or scientifically valid. As with any genetic test, it’s essential to consult with a healthcare provider or genetic counselor to understand the results and implications.

While genetic testing offers many benefits, it’s essential to consider the ethical and social implications of these tests as well. Privacy concerns are a significant issue, as genetic information is highly sensitive and can have far-reaching implications for individuals and their families. In some cases, genetic test results could be used by insurance companies or employers to make decisions about coverage or employment, potentially leading to discrimination or stigmatization.

Additionally, interpreting genetic test results can be complex and challenging, especially when it comes to assessing disease risk. Not all genetic mutations are created equal, and having a particular gene variant doesn’t necessarily mean an individual will develop a specific condition. Understanding the nuances of genetic testing requires specialized knowledge and expertise, which is why it’s crucial to work with a qualified healthcare provider or genetic counselor when considering genetic testing.
